I don't know how many people here actually read the book, if you haven't you should be ashamed of yourself. But Card has just gave Chair Entertainment the rights to make the Battle Room game into an actual video game. For anyone who doesn't know what it is its basically a form of capture the flag. Players are in a huge 3d environment with zero gravity and they are given anywhere between 0 to several obstacles to hide or move between. Each player on each team has a freeze gun and when they shoot other players with it the parts they shot at are frozen in place (ie: shoot the head/neck they cant look any other direction now). The goal of the game if I remember correctly is to score the most kills while incurring the least losses and capture the enemies gate. Ever since I read the book I've always thought and talked to friends about how great of a game this would be, finally we get to see it.

The game would get repetitive after a while I think. It would also be extremely difficult to successfully design a set of controls which could be used to bounce off walls/objects in a specified direction. I suppose just looking at the area you want to move to would be a sufficient way to aim your movements. The other problem is body movement. Since you can contort your body into other positions, and possibly change directions slightly in midair, it would be difficult to achieve this sort of thing. Third, you're a COMMANDER, so you have to be able to shout orders. If its an online game, this requires people to have microphones or type. Not to mention, the commander isn't anything special, just a regular soldier. It would be pointless to have one in that case. I'm also reminded of idiots like Leeroy Jenkins. If it's single player, you have to deal with crappy AI, and severely limited ordering abilities. I don't think you'd effectively be able to command. Then again, maybe not.
